web browserEven though more than 60% of visitors visting this blog is using Firefox, the worlwide usage share of web browsers still shows that Internet Explorer (IE) si still the top web browser in the world.

If you look at the chart on the left, IE still holds a big 72.22% usage leaving the others way behind. Why?

Technically, I would not be able to answer you as I am using Firefox as my main web browser while IE and Chrome are used only for making sure that this blog has no problem on the other two.

Personally, I would be able to give my opinion as to why IE is still very popular out there. Firstly, most people use Microsoft Windows instead of Mac or Linux. The fact that Windows is more user friendly to the common people, makes it almost the default OS for most computers.

Therefore, IE comes installed with Windows and it is ready to use with some minor settings required. Some of the computer vendors would even do it for their customers without any extra charge. All the user needs to do is click IE and they are connected to the internet.

Secondly, this is related to the common people who bought computers above. Most of them thought that by installing another web browser, they can no longer use their IE. In fact, when I got my first computer, I had that very same idea too and therefore, I stick to IE.

Only after getting to know more about computers and internet, I leaned that a computer can run multiple web browsers at the same time since they are nothing but just like any another program that can be run on a computer. It took me a while to have the guts to install Firefox and I have never looked back since then.

In conclusion, those are the two major factors, in my opinion, that let IE be where they are right now and not because they are more superior to the other browsers. I am sure IE fanatics would shoot me down like flies when they read this. But then, I am just stating my opinion and nothing more.

To bloggers out there, do not dismiss IE if you are already using other web browsers. Make sure that you test load your blog on IE to ensure that they have no problem so that the 72%+ IE users are able to read it. If not, your blog would be skipped and that would be your loss.
